如何在Linux下查看包的架构
作为一名经验丰富的开发者,我将在下面的文章中向刚入行的小白介绍如何在Linux下查看包的架构。我会使用表格展示步骤,并在每一步中给出相应的代码和注释。
整体流程
以下是整个过程的步骤和说明:
步骤 | 代码 | 说明 |
---|---|---|
1 | dpkg -s <package-name> |
使用dpkg 命令查看包的详细信息 |
2 | Architecture: <architecture> |
在输出中查找包的架构信息 |
现在让我们逐步了解每个步骤所需的代码和注释。
步骤 1:使用 dpkg 命令查看包的详细信息
首先,我们需要使用dpkg
命令来查看包的详细信息。这个命令可以帮助我们获取包的架构信息。下面是相应的代码:
dpkg -s <package-name>
<package-name>
:替换成你想要查看的包的名称。
这个命令会输出包的详细信息,其中包括架构信息。
步骤 2:在输出中查找包的架构信息
在步骤 1 的输出中,我们需要查找包的架构信息。这个信息通常以Architecture
关键字开头。下面是相应的代码和注释:
Architecture: <architecture>
<architecture>
:这是包的架构信息,例如amd64
或arm64
等。
这样,我们就可以根据输出中的架构信息确定包的架构。
包关系图
下面是一个用mermaid语法表示的包关系图:
erDiagram
PACKAGE }|..| DEPENDENCY : has
DEPENDENCY }|--|| PACKAGE : depends on
在这个关系图中,PACKAGE代表包,DEPENDENCY代表依赖关系。
甘特图
下面是一个用mermaid语法表示的甘特图:
gantt
dateFormat YYYY-MM-DD
title 查看包架构的时间表
section 步骤
安装 dpkg : done, 2021-01-01, 1d
查看包的详细信息 : done, 2021-01-02, 1d
查找架构信息 : done, 2021-01-03, 1d
在这个甘特图中,我们可以清楚地看到每个步骤的安排和耗时。
总结一下,通过以上的步骤和代码,你可以在Linux下查看包的架构信息。希望这篇文章对你有所帮助!